Tax Glossary Definition
XBRL (eXtensible Business Reporting Language) filing refers to the submission of financial statements and other reports in a standardized electronic format prescribed by the Ministry of Corporate Affairs (MCA) in India. The purpose of XBRL is to make financial data more transparent, consistent, and easily analyzable by regulators, investors, and other stakeholders. It enables automation in data collection and analysis, ensuring accuracy and comparability across companies.
Companies that fall under specific categories—such as listed companies, companies with a paid-up capital of ₹5 crore or more, or a turnover of ₹100 crore or more—are required to file their annual financial statements (Balance Sheet, Profit and Loss Account, Cash Flow Statement, and related notes) in XBRL format through the MCA portal.
Example: A listed company prepares its annual financial statements for FY 2024–25 and files the Balance Sheet and Profit & Loss Account in XBRL format using the MCA-provided taxonomy
Discover why we're one of India's most trusted Pro Tax Filers, built on a foundation of accuracy and reliability.
We ensure maximum tax benefits.
Taxes? Handled by our CAs and experts.
Reliable, year-round tax support at no cost.
Satisfaction or your money back came twice.
Mobile App Available on: